Jacob Fortune-Llyod is now widely recognized because of his role of Townes, a gay man who happens to be Beth Harmon's crush in The Queen's Gambit. To better get into character for Townes, the actor said that he took inspiration from the late American actor Rock Hudson.
Jacob Fortune-Lloyd (born 18 January ) is an English actor. He has played the role of Francis Weston in the BBC series Wolf Hall (), Francesco Salviati in Medici (), Townes in the Netflix chess period drama The Queen's Gambit (), Grigory Petrov in The Great (), detective Charles Whiteman in Bodies () and Brian Epstein in.
